Weather and Climate in Commerce
Seasonal Temperatures: Commerce has a typical summer high of 90°F and a winter low of 24°F. And the yearly rainfall here is about 45 inches, while the snowfall is around 9 inch(es) on average.
Air Quality: The Average air quality index rating is usually 64, which is higher than the national average of 58. The index rating at or below 100 is considered satisfactory.

Medicare
For the first 20 days of a eligible nursing home stay, Medicare will compensate for the entire cost and a considerable percentage of the covered fees until day 100. After that, Medicare will not pay for any {portion|part|segment} of the cost. While this is adequate for short-term care, those who require long-term care must either pay out of pocket or seek monetary assistance from different avenues.

Medicaid
For those who meet the requirements, Medicaid covers the cost for skilled nursing care when Medicare stops funding after 100 days. In addition, it covers the costs of living in an validated nursing home. However, because Medicaid entitlement requirements are strict and complex, not all senior citizens are eligible for benefits.
Veterans Benefits
Veterans receiving a VA pension may be eligible for the VA's Aid and Attendance benefits. VA Aid and Attendance is a monthly allowance that veterans and their spouses can employ for covering for long-term care, such as skilled nursing care.
